I have been suffering with Fibromyalgia for three years and only now have been properly diagnosed a few months ago after changing my doctor.

I get shooting pains in a lot of areas of my body, numbness in my toes and hands and my joints are painful especially in the morning when I get out of bed. When I climb the stairs my legs go tight like I have done a sprint and I get tired easily.

I am on Gabapentin and paracetamol and co codamol. I cannot take Ibuprofen or aspirin any more as I now have stomach issues because of taking narproxen/Ibuprofen for a long time (which I now know did help as the pain and fatigue has worsted again).

I had the mirena coil for 16 years and thought that it maybe the cause of the Fibromyalgia. I had this taken out about three months ago and was told I needed a hysterectomy as I had 3 fibroid, one 6 cm, one 3 cm and one 2 cm. I still have the pains etc. and am know wondering if the Fibroids could be causing some of my symptoms.

Has any one else had the same issues.
